#1a9c3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a9c3c is composed of 10.2% red, 61.2%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 135.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 35.7%. #1a9c3c color hex could be obtained by blending #34ff78 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1a9c3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a9c3c has RGB values of R:26, G:156,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1743932.

Shades and Tints of #1a9c3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a9c3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595d5a is the less saturated color, while #05b132 is the most saturated one.
